Insooni is unexpectedly eliminated from ‘I am a Singer’

Insooni has become the 10th contestant to be eliminated from the singing survival show “I am a Singer.”

On the show that aired on Dec. 11, the 54-year-old performed the song “Youth.” The show’s theme was Sanulrim, after the rock band, and the group’s lead singer, Kim Chang-hoon, was the guest of honor.

The highlight of the special-edition show was when T.O.P from Big Bang performed as a guest artist alongside singer Gummy. “Rascal,” the song performed by the two, won the second round of the contest.

Insooni was ranked fifth during the second round of the show but only made it to the seventh spot during the final round. Thus, the singer was eliminated.

The elimination came as a surprise as Insooni was one of the top performers on the show, and many assumed she would “graduate” to other opportunities rather than be eliminated. Singer Park Wan-kyu will replace Insooni on the show from Dec. 18.

Despite being forced to leave the show, Insooni received some good news in her personal life as her high school-aged daughter has been admitted to Stanford University in the United States. According to local media, the high-profile singer’s daughter received the acceptance on Dec. 10 and will study sociology and communications.
